The first thing I do every morning is read the Victoria Advocate online. I stop at the obituaries and scroll through the names looking for someone familiar. When I find that name, I’ll read the entire article because more often than not I’ll come across something I didn’t know about them. I was just telling a group of friends it doesn’t surprise me because back then we didn’t brag. If a person is that good; someone else will parse their glory.

That leads me to why I like the approach this administration is taking.

I am more convinced today of how happy I am in my choice for president. I found and reposted a meme I found that describes Joe Biden: He doesn’t brag, whine, write crazy tweets, or participate in racist rhetoric.

Just last week his conference call with the governors did not include any fighting, just “we’ll get you what you need.” Some on the right took it to mean Biden was giving up. The right seems to forget that Trump used his task force TV appearances as a dog and pony show. Trump gave up on COVID-19 three months prior to the election and three months after. Even worse, his administration refused to cooperate with the incoming administration. That’s giving up.

Republicans have switched tactics since Trump was in office. They used to ignore Trump’s low approval numbers and praise the stock market. Today, they highlight Biden’s low approval numbers, ignore the booming stock market and good economic numbers.
